Andreas Rheinhardt efc323062c fftools/ffmpeg_filter: Avoid DynBuf API to improve error checks
choose_pix_fmts() used the dynamic buffer API to write strings;
as is common among uses of this API, only opening the dynamic buffer
was checked, but not the end result, leading to crashes in case
of allocation failure.
Furthermore, some static strings were duplicated; the allocations
performed here were not properly checked: Allocation failure would
be treated as "could not determine pixel format".
The first issue is fixed by switching to the AVBPrint API which allows
to easily perform checks at the end. Furthermore, the internal buffer
avoids almost all allocations in case the AVBPrint is used.
The AVBPrint also allows to solve the second issue in an elegant way,
because it allows to return the static strings directly.

Andreas Rheinhardt a132614bba fftools/ffmpeg: Avoid temporary frame
send_frame_to_filters() sends a frame to all the filters that
need said frame; for every filter except the last one this involves
creating a reference to the frame, because
av_buffersrc_add_frame_flags() by default takes ownership of
the supplied references. Yet said function has a flag which
changes its behaviour to create a reference itself.
This commit uses this flag and stops creating the references itself;
this allows to remove the spare AVFrame holding the temporary
references; it also avoids unreferencing said frame.

Anton Khirnov bd55552d69 ffmpeg: rewrite setting the stream disposition
Currently, the code doing this is spread over several places and may
behave in unexpected ways. E.g. automatic 'default' marking is only done
for streams fed by complex filtergraphs. It is also applied in the order
in which the output streams are initialized, which is effectively
random.

Move processing the dispositions at the end of open_output_file(), when
we already have all the necessary information.

Apply the automatic default marking only if no explicit -disposition
options were supplied by the user, and apply it to the first stream of
each type (excluding attached pics) when there is more than one stream
of that type and no default markings were copied from the input streams.

Explicitly document the new behavior.

Changes the results of some tests, where the output file gets a default
disposition, while it previously did not.
